| I'm wondering if there is a way to accomplish this from my fvwm2rc or do
| I have to use some kind of shellwrapper like:
| 
|     export HOST=`uname -n | cut -d . -f 1`
| 
|     if [ -e ~/lib/fvwm2rc.\$HOST/fvwm2rc.$HOST ]; then
|       . ~/lib/fvwm2rc.\$HOST/fvwm2rc.$HOST
|     fi
| 
| I want to add diffrent configurations to my default one depending on
| which machine I'm on. I'm aware of that I can use the source command,
| but I would like to test if there actually is a file to be sourced
| aswell.

Well, I invoke fvwm like this:

        fvwm -cmd "PipeRead fvwmrc"

and fvwmrc is a shell script to emit an fvwm rc file on stdout.
Perhaps you may want to adopt this approach, or some obvious variant?
